AAC vs AMR at a glance

AAC is the successor to MP3 — better quality at the same bit rate, used by Apple Music, YouTube and most streaming platforms. AMR is the codec built for phone calls — optimized for speech at very low bit rates, but rarely playable outside dedicated voicemail or call-recording apps.
